For an endothermic reaction where `DeltaH` represent the enthalpy of reaction in kj`//`mol, the minimum value for the energy of activation will be:

A

less than `DeltaH`

B

equal to `DeltaH`

C

more than `DeltaH`

D

equal to zero

Text Solution

Verified by Experts

The correct Answer is:
C
